How to help Africa and African children

You don't need to be a volunteer to help orphan African children. There're already running organizations or charity groups which you can help with sending money. I can't give a guarantee for ifever they're legally valid or not but I tried to make a list of possibly legal ones, with good referances, take your own risk. 
Ripple Africa is a Malawi based charity organization. You can see their activities . They're collecting money for many things, including primary school tools to teacher salaries. They also gather help for health care. 

Self Help Africa is made of two organizations which have been created during great Ethiopian famine. Here's a list of how to help them but I couldn't find an online fund.

Link Ethiopia is another charity based on the northern side. They accept online donation from here.  They mainly focus on education, clean water or toilets (which are very important subjects in fighting with illnesses). 

Volunteer Africa is another charity, based on volunteer work, you can apply from here but we don't know them and can't give guarantee for your safety, contact them for questions. 

Somali Poverty Relief is another charity organization, working with donations which has focused on Somali primary schools. 

Helping Hands Healing is a charity organization with some completed projects . They mainly focus on repairement of primary schools and accept donations. 

HopeAfrica is another charity organization focusing on Malawi, they accept online payments. They mainly focus on food and clean water

Women in Progress is another charity, which focuses on woman-development but as far as I understood they only focus on volunteer work. 

Make a difference now is a charity focused on education and children. They explain where they use money and accept donations.
